Cotton Tote Bag Weights Compared: 100g vs 140g vs 220g vs 340g vs 475g
Quick answer:for everyday giveaways and large campaigns, choose 100–140 g/m² cotton.
For a sturdier, more premium tote that customers keep using for years, choose 200–220 g/m². For heavyweight branded merchandise, retail packaging, or a luxury feel, choose 340–475 g/m².
The table below breaks down every weight we offer so you can match the fabric to your project.
Cotton tote bag weights compared
| Weight (g/m²) | Feel & look | Best for | Durability | Typical price tier |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 100 g/m² | Very light, thin, almost paper-like cotton | High-volume giveaways, single-event campaigns, conference handouts | Lower – best for short-term or light use | Most affordable |
| 140 g/m² | Light but substantial, the standard everyday tote weight | General branding, retail giveaways, schools, everyday shopping bags | Good for regular use | Budget to mid-range |
| 180–200 g/m² | Noticeably thicker, smooth surface, structured shape | Corporate gifts, conferences, retail packaging that should feel a step above basic | Strong, holds shape well | Mid-range |
| 220 g/m² | Heavyweight, reinforced handles, premium feel | Shopping bags, company events, retail packaging requiring extra strength | High – built for repeated daily use | Mid to premium |
| 230 g/m² organic twill | Structured twill weave, GOTS-certified organic cotton, gusseted shape | Sustainability-focused brands, premium retail, corporate gifts | High, with extra shape from the gusset | Premium |
| 340 g/m² | Solid, luxury weight, professional construction | High-end retail packaging, premium campaigns, long-term brand visibility | Very high – lasts for years | Premium |
| 475 g/m² | Our heaviest canvas, stiff structure, most solid feel in the range | Heavy-duty retail, market/shopping bags, statement merchandise | Maximum – the most robust option we offer | Highest |
How to choose the right weight
If your bags will be used once or twice
A single event, a conference giveaway, a one-off campaign: 100–140 g/m² is the most cost-effective choice. You get a clean printable surface without paying for durability you won't need.
If your bags will be reused regularly
A shop's everyday carrier bag, a corporate gift customers keep using, 200–220 g/m² offers the best balance of durability, feel, and price.
If you want the bag itself to communicate quality
Premium retail packaging, a flagship product launch, a brand that wants to be remembered, 340–475 g/m² gives the most substantial, long-lasting result.
If sustainability certification matters to your brand
Our 230 g/m² organic twill is made from GOTS-certified organic cotton and features a structured, gusseted shape.

What does g/m² (GSM) mean for a cotton tote bag?
g/m², also written GSM, measures the weight of the cotton fabric per square metre. A higher number means a thicker, heavier, and generally more durable fabric. It is the standard way to compare cotton bag quality across suppliers.
What is the most popular cotton tote bag weight?
140 g/m² is the most commonly ordered weight for custom printed tote bags. It balances cost, print quality, and everyday durability, which is why it is used across budget, classic, and short-handle tote bag lines.
Is a heavier cotton tote bag always better?
Not necessarily. A heavier fabric costs more and is better suited to bags meant for long-term, repeated use. For single-event giveaways or large-volume campaigns, a lighter 100–140 g/m² bag is usually the more practical and cost-effective choice.
Which weight is best for printing detailed logos or artwork?
All weights in our range provide a smooth, even printing surface. Heavier fabrics (200 g/m² and above) tend to hold sharp print edges slightly better over repeated washing and use, but lighter weights are perfectly suitable for most logo and single-colour designs.
What is the difference between 220 g/m² and 340 g/m²?
220 g/m² is a heavy-duty everyday weight suited to shopping bags and corporate events. 340 g/m² is our premium tier, with a noticeably more substantial, professional-grade feel suited to high-end retail packaging and long-term brand merchandise.
